Datuk Seri among 25 nabbed at ‘wild party’ in Janda Baik

 

Bentong district police chief Zaiham Kahar said those arrested at the party were foreigners and locals aged between 18 and 64. (PDRM Facebook pic)

KUANTAN: A “Datuk Seri” was among 25 people arrested in a police raid on a “wild party”, where drugs were used freely, at a bungalow in Janda Baik, Pahang.

Bentong district police chief Zaiham Kahar said those arrested were foreigners and locals aged between 18 and 64.

He said police also seized drugs suspected to be ketamine and ecstasy pills worth about RM800 in the 1am raid.

Early investigations showed that the bungalow had been rented for RM15,000.

“The preliminary urine screening of the suspects, comprising 15 men and 10 women, found all of them were positive for drugs.

“One person among those arrested is a 46-year-old Datuk Seri and police are still investigating who organised the party.

“All the suspects have been remanded for four days from today for investigations under Section 12(2) and Section 15(1)(a) of the Dangerous Drugs Act 1952,” he said in a statement.

Zaiham also thanked the public, especially the residents of Bentong, for the tip-off. - FMT
